MANILA, Philippines – As of 11:00 pm, June 28, Tropical Depression Gorio has now developed into a Tropical Storm and was estimated to be 250 kilometers (km) east of Maasin, Southern Leyte.
According to the state weather bureau PAGASA, Tropical Storm Gorio is expected to be in the vicinity of Catarman, Northern Samar by Saturday evening, June 29.
Signal no. 1 has been put up in Quezon, Polillo Island, Camarines Norte, Camarines Sur, Marinduque, Romblon, as well as Aklan, Capiz and Northeastern Iloilo.
Gorio currently has speeds of 65 kph near the center and is expected be in the vicinity of Cabanatuan City and at 390 km northwest of Dagupan City on Sunday and Monday evenings, respectively.
Residents living in low lying and mountainous areas in these locations are warned to be careful against possible flashfloods and landslides.
PAGASA also advised people living in coastal areas to be alert against big waves or storm surges generated by this tropical storm. – Rappler.com
